Demand It


Make 2014 a year of Sharing


“Bless the Lord, O my soul: and all that is within me, bless his holy name.” – Psalm 103:1

When you wake up and dread the day –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When you’re feeling lonely and lost the way –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When the love is gone and you want to cry –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When the news is bad and your anger’s high –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When you’ve lost your job and fear sets in –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When you can’t break free from the recurring sin –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When the one you love has passed away –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When depression sets in and you just can’t pray –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When the car won’t start and you’re running late –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.
When your patience is thin and you just can’t wait – tell your soul to Bless the Lord.

I believe you see the pattern here without me being so obvious.  This is not a life free of trouble or anger or strife or temptations, but it is a life that can be centered on something greater than your day to day trials.  The Lord is in control of all things and is worthy to be blessed regardless of the circumstances.  David was being pursued by armies and assassins throughout much of his life, simply because he followed the calling of God on his life.  In all things, good and bad, David was grounded in his understanding that his only authority in life was God Almighty and that despite his circumstances, mistakes and success’ he would demand that his soul cry out blessings upon the Lord.  His soul belonged to the Lord, and he knew this and was therefore commanding his soul to bless the Lord in all things.  This is the example I leave with you today, that although your life seems off track and out of control at times, your soul is always directly in line with God’s plan and is capable of blessing the Lord, despite your inadequacies and unrighteousness.  Sometimes, you need to remind yourself of this fact, by commanding your soul to Bless the Lord in all things.

Discovering Peace



Read It, Learn It, Live It, Share It


“Therefore, since we have been justified through faith, we have peace with God through our Lord Jesus Christ, through whom we have gained access by faith into this grace in which we now stand.” – Romans 5:1-2

Sometimes, faith is all you have to hold on to. There are those days when life just doesn't make sense and we must fully embrace His sovereignty and grace.  The realization that everything we have in this life is temporary and that it can all be lost in an instant causes one to stop and reflect on the important things in life.  Love, family, friends and above all else my relationship with Jesus Christ.  There are unanswered questions, and there always will be.  Why did this happen, why do bad things happen, why did I lose my job, why did he get cancer, why did she leave me?  These are the times I fall back on my faith, and push aside the demands for answers to my questions, and trust that God is in control and can get me through the difficulties that come along my path in life.

I try to remain focused on the end game.  This life albeit full of strife and obstacles and rich blessings is also very temporary.  I am determined to push past the pains and live for the glory of God Almighty.  His plan is always perfect, and is not dependent upon meeting my objections in life.  I need to continue to align my life to His expectations and pursue His purpose, allowing the Holy Spirit to work within me and through me in this life, for as long as He allows me to.  I’ve accepted that He loves me and will deliver upon his promise of eternal life with Him one day.  To quote a song:
“The sun comes up, it’s a new day dawning
Time to sing your songs again
Whatever may pass, and whatever lies before me…
Let me be singing when the evening comes.
Bless the Lord oh my soul . . . Ohhh my soul
Worship His holy name.”  - Matt Redmann (10000 Reasons)

Trust in His sovereignty and His love for you.  He will carry you through your pains and problems.  When you are weak He is strong.  Be blessed my friends.
